Dumpster Rental Process Saratoga Springs

Simple Process, No Complications

First, we talk through your project to determine the right dumpster size. A 20-yard container handles most residential cleanouts and small renovations, while larger construction projects might need a 30-yard or 40-yard roll-off. We’ll help you figure out what makes sense without overselling you on capacity you don’t need.

Next, we schedule delivery for when you actually need it. We’ll confirm the best spot for placement—whether that’s your driveway, a construction site, or (with proper permits) on the street. We need about 60 feet of straight-line space and 23 feet of vertical clearance for our truck to safely deliver and position your container.

Once your dumpster is in place, you fill it at your own pace. Keep the debris level with the top rails, and stick to approved materials—no hazardous waste, paint, or chemicals. When you’re ready for pickup, give us a call and we’ll haul it away, typically within 24 hours.

Do I need a permit to place a dumpster in Saratoga Springs?

Yes, you’ll need a permit if you’re placing the dumpster on city streets or blocking sidewalks. You’ll also need a Right of Way permit for street placement. Contact the City of Saratoga Springs Code Enforcement Department before your delivery to get the proper permits. If you’re keeping the dumpster on your private property like your driveway, you typically won’t need a permit, but we can help you confirm based on your specific situation.
For most residential projects like kitchen or bathroom remodels, a 20-yard dumpster works well. It holds about 10 pickup truck loads of debris. Whole-house cleanouts or larger renovations might need a 30-yard container. Small projects like single-room cleanouts can often use a 15-yard dumpster. We can’t accept hazardous materials like paint, chemicals, motor oil, batteries, or propane tanks. Electronics, tires, and appliances with refrigerants also require special handling. Construction debris, furniture, household junk, and yard waste are all fine. If you’re unsure about specific items, just ask when you book. We’d rather clarify upfront than deal with complications during pickup.
We need about 60 feet of straight-line space for our delivery truck to position the dumpster safely. There should also be 23 feet of vertical clearance—no low-hanging branches or power lines. Most driveways work fine, but we can also place containers on level ground at construction sites. Before delivery, make sure the area is clear of vehicles, materials, or other obstacles that might block our truck.
